problem with removing rails is all the infrastructure in the infield...lamp posts, finish line equipment, drainage channels, tote board, ponds, etc.

if those issues could be dealt with, it would be safer...give the horses another place to go to avoid an accident.

by the way, the Van Wert fair in Ohio runs a day of thoroughbred on a track with no inside rail; most steeplechases also do not have rails.
